The Save as PDF Plugin by PDFCrowd pl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Arbitrary Function Invocation in all versions up to, and including, 4.6.1 via the pdf_created_callback shortcode attribute. The eval_shortcode() function copies any non-button_/non-email_ shortcode attribute verbatim into a custom options array without sanitization, allowlist enforcement, or capability checks, and create_button() AES-encrypts that array — including the attacker-supplied callback value — and embeds the resulting blob in the rendered button HTML; when the blob is later POSTed to the unauthenticated wp_ajax_nopriv_save_as_pdf_pdfcrowd endpoint, save_as_pdf_pdfcrowd() decrypts it and invokes $options['pdf_created_callback'] as a PHP callable at line 1722 with no is_callable() guard, no allowlist, and no capability check.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Contributor-level access and above, to invoke arbitrary PHP functions or static class methods with plugin option data as the sole argument, enabling disclosure of the site's stored PDFCrowd API key and username or further server-side abuse. Note that the encryption boundary does not mitigate this vector because the server itself encrypts the attacker-chosen callback during shortcode rendering, supplying any authenticated Contributor with a cryptographically valid blob that any unauthenticated visitor can subsequently replay to trigger invocation.
